Transaction e587c6cc89211c961341a26703c0b965910cfc79642a265d38c4ae21e6751e3e

1 Input
2 Outputs
  • e587c6cc89211c961341a26703c0b965910cfc79642a265d38c4ae21e6751e3e:0
  • value  10041543
    address  18CDa4MoDMKMFCHAN1dK6EJQkNFKfaerH1
  • e587c6cc89211c961341a26703c0b965910cfc79642a265d38c4ae21e6751e3e:1
  • value  5918927
    address  12Wo5korcT77xFsg9Y9az1R9bkEvXyGhxc